What is the purpose of a sounding device in a watertight compartment?

The purpose of a sounding device in a watertight compartment is primarily to measure the water level and detect flooding. This tool is crucial for assessing the stability and safety of compartments that may become compromised. By providing an accurate indication of water accumulation, crew members can make informed decisions regarding damage control measures, such as the need to initiate dewatering procedures or seal off affected areas to prevent further flooding. This proactive monitoring is essential for maintaining the integrity of the vessel and ensuring the safety of those on board.
